§ 13-1306-C. Powers and duties
(a) General rule.--A school police officer appointed under section 1302-C(b)1 shall possess and exercise all the following powers and duties:
(1) To enforce good order in school buildings, on school buses and on school grounds in the respective school entities or nonpublic schools. For purposes of this paragraph, the term “school bus” shall include a vehicle leased by the school entity or nonpublic school to transport students and a vehicle of mass transit used by students to go to and from school and school activities when the school police officer responds to a report of an incident involving a breach of good order or violation of law.
(b) Specific powers.--If authorized by the court, a school police officer who is a law enforcement officer employed by a school entity or nonpublic school whose responsibilities, including work hours, are established by the school entity or nonpublic school, may exercise the same powers as exercised under authority of law or ordinance by the police of the municipality in which the school property is located.
